Industrial Furnaces and Kilns

This nano aerogel insulation blanket functions well in high-heat locations like commercial heaters and ceramic kilns. It keeps warm inside, which cuts power usage. The material remains secure also at temperature levels above 1000 ° C. It does not shed or launch hazardous fumes.

Petrochemische en raffinageapparatuur

Pijpleidingen, activatoren, and tank in oil and gas plants require solid thermal defense. The blanket covers tightly around bent surfaces without losing efficiency. Het is bestand tegen vocht, chemicaliën, en fysieke spanning. Upkeep prices drop due to the fact that the insulation lasts much longer.

Power Generation Equipments

In thermal and nuclear power terminals, warm administration is important. The aerogel blanket protects vapor lines, ketels, en generatoren. Its lightweight nature decreases tons on support frameworks. Operators see better system effectiveness and less heat losses.

Lucht- en ruimtevaart en defensie

Jet engines, uitlaatsystemen, and rocket elements encounter extreme temperature levels. This blanket offers dependable insulation without adding much weight. It fulfills strict fire safety and security criteria. Military and aerospace engineers depend on it for mission-critical uses.

Fire Protection Barriers

Buildings and transport systems utilize this product as a passive fire obstacle. It blocks fire spread and reduces warmth transfer throughout fires. The blanket is slim yet offers high defense. It suits tight rooms where conventional insulation can not go.

Electric Vehicle Battery Loads

Battery security is a leading issue in electrical vehicles. The aerogel covering divides individual cells to stop thermal runaway. It stays awesome under anxiety and does not catch fire. Car manufacturers utilize it to satisfy international safety policies.

5 FAQs of High-Temperature Insulation Inorganic Grade a Non-Flammable Nano Aerogel Insulation Blanket

Frequently Asked Questions About High-Temperature Insulation Inorganic Grade Non-Flammable Nano Aerogel Blanket

Waar is deze isolatiedeken van gemaakt??

This blanket uses inorganic nano aerogel as its main material. It contains no organic binders. The structure is highly porous and lightweight. It stays stable even under extreme heat.

Why is it called non-flammable?

The blanket will not catch fire. Het brandt niet, smelten, or release toxic smoke when exposed to flame. This is because it is made entirely from inorganic substances. These materials do not support combustion.

Welke temperaturen kan hij aan?

It works well in environments up to 1000°C (1832°F). Performance remains strong even after long exposure to high heat. Thermal conductivity stays low across the full temperature range.

Waar wordt deze deken gebruikt??

Common applications include industrial furnaces, uitlaatsystemen, energiecentrales, en ruimtevaartcomponenten. It also protects pipes, kleppen, and reactors in chemical processing. Any place needing reliable, lichtgewicht, fire-safe insulation can use this product.

Hoe verhoudt het zich tot traditionele isolatie??

It is much thinner but offers better thermal resistance than mineral wool or ceramic fiber. It weighs less and takes up less space. Installation is easier. It also lasts longer because it resists moisture, trillingen, and thermal cycling without breaking down.
